   Google tells employees they need to double their work every 6 months to keep   
   up with AI   
      
   Date:   
   Mon, 24 Nov 2025 13:03:00 +0000   
      
   Description:   
   Google wants to double AI capacity every six months, but it wants to keep a   
   lid on cost and power consumption.   
      
   FULL STORY   
      
   Googles AI and Infrastructure VP, Amin Vahdat, has reportedly warned    
   employees that the company must double serving capacity every six months in   
   order to keep up with demand for AI tools .    
      
    CNBC reported the news hit staff in a company all-hands, during which Vahdat   
   revealed that Google would need to scale the next 1000x in 4-5 years.    
      
   Vahdat noted all of this was needed while maintaining the same cost and power   
   consumption, spelling out a challenging future of both colossal capacity   
   increases and equally mighty efficienty improvements.   
      
   Google needs to double AI progress every six months   
      
   Vahdat explained the 1000x scale, targeted for around the end of the decade,   
   would need to come at essentially the same cost and increasingly, the same   
   power, the same energy level.    
      
   Clearly, the roadmap consists of multiple elements. Google continues to work   
   on expanding its infrastructure, like AI and cloud data centers, but its also   
   rolling out more of its own hardware (like TPUs) to reduce reliance on   
   third-party companies. Nvidia has profited hugely from that, for instance.    
      
   Googles seventh-generation TPU, Ironwood, claims a 30x power efficiency boost   
   over 2018 models.    
      
   And on those third-party concerns, many Nvidia chips are being flagged as    
   sold out, per The Verge , which has slowed down some rollouts across the   
   industry, including Googles own AI features.    
      
   Separately, Google CEO Sundar Pichai has also warned 2026 would be intense    
   due to AI competition and compute demand. Google has publicly acknowledged AI   
   bubble concerns, but Pichai deems underinvesting in AI even riskier.
